Emmanuel Agyemang-Badu started his career with Berlin FC before playing for Berekum Arsenal between 2007 to 2009.

Badu moved to Asante Kotoko where he had a season long loan and joined Spanish side Recreativo de Huelva.

Life became so good when he finally signed for Italian side Udinese in January 2010 from Berlin FC. Badu played for Udinese for 10 years.

The 2009 U-20 FIFA World Cup champion has had a great career but had a very poor start in Ghana, financially.

In the Ghana Premier League, Agyeman Badu was nowhere near the best paid players especially at Berekum Arsenal.

“My salary at Berekum Arsenal was 30 cedis,” Agyeman Badu Emmanuel disclosed.

The talented midfielder’s revelation summarises how hard life is for footballers in Ghana’s domestic league. Things always change when players move outside the country to seek for greener pastures and Agyeman Badu is no different.

Agyeman Badu’s finances improved greatly when he played his football in Europe.
